Why AI matters at this scale
Montgomery County, PA, is a large county government administering a wide array of essential public services for over 850,000 residents. Its operations span public safety, health, transportation, property assessment, permitting, and social services. With a workforce of 1,001–5,000 employees, the organization manages massive, complex datasets and a vast physical infrastructure. At this scale, even marginal efficiency gains through automation or predictive insights can translate into millions of dollars in saved taxpayer funds and significantly improved quality of life for constituents.
For a public sector entity of this size, AI is not about futuristic technology but pragmatic problem-solving. The county faces persistent challenges: aging infrastructure, rising service demands, budget constraints, and the need for greater transparency and equity. AI offers tools to move from reactive to proactive governance. It can analyze patterns across disparate departments—connecting dots between public works data, emergency calls, and economic activity—to optimize resource allocation, prevent problems, and deliver services more effectively and fairly.
Concrete AI Opportunities with ROI Framing
1. Predictive Infrastructure Management: Deploying AI models on IoT sensor data and historical maintenance records for roads, bridges, and water systems can predict failure points. The ROI is direct: a 2020 study by the ASCE found that proactive maintenance saves $6-$10 for every $1 spent versus reactive repairs. For a county with billions in infrastructure assets, this represents massive long-term savings and reduced service disruptions.
2. Intelligent Permit and Licensing Automation: Implementing NLP and computer vision to auto-process construction plans, business licenses, and health inspections can cut processing times by 50-70%. This accelerates economic development, improves citizen satisfaction, and frees skilled staff to handle complex exceptions. The ROI includes increased permit revenue from faster cycles and reduced overtime costs.
3. Data-Driven Public Safety Resource Allocation: Using AI to analyze historical 911 call data, weather, and event schedules can optimize patrol routes and pre-position emergency responders. Predictive policing models focused on place-based analytics (not individuals) can reduce crime rates. The ROI is measured in improved emergency response times, potential reductions in property crime, and more efficient use of a large public safety budget.
Deployment Risks Specific to This Size Band
For a large county government, AI deployment risks are significant but manageable. Technical Debt & Data Silos: Legacy systems from different eras and vendors create fragmented data landscapes, requiring substantial upfront investment in data integration before AI models can be effective. Procurement & Vendor Lock-in: Public bidding processes can favor large, established vendors whose proprietary AI solutions may limit future flexibility and create long-term dependency. Change Management at Scale: Rolling out new AI-driven workflows across dozens of departments with thousands of employees requires extensive training and can meet resistance from staff concerned about job displacement or increased surveillance. Public Trust & Algorithmic Bias: Any AI system used in public decision-making (e.g., resource allocation, risk assessment) must be transparent and auditable to avoid perpetuating bias and maintain constituent trust, necessitating robust governance frameworks that may slow implementation.
